All About The Animals

Scattered across the showgrounds this year we have new educational displays on your favourite farmyard animals.

With seven new diagrams to find on site, you and your children can explore the anatomy of pigs, cows, sheep and chickens. Our variety of drawings also detail how milk from cows and goats gets transformed into other favourite dairy products, and in the final diagram you can test if your children can name some of the common tack required for looking after horses.

All the Fun of the Fair

Celebrating their 20th anniversary at the Show, G Force Amusements has something for everyone within the Balmoral Show's Funfair.

Whether you'd like to see the whole Show from the top of the legendary Big Wheel or are ready for some heart racing rides, we promise you won't forget your visit!

This year, the Funfair is also hosting two sensory sessions when music and noise levels will be reduced, sensory lighting effects such as strobes and smoke machines will not be in use, and rides where possible will be slowed down. Please be aware, often a family favourite, the Logan Hall (Cattle Hall) is a very busy area and requires closure at certain times whilst cattle are being moved to and from judging.

This is for the safety of the cattle, the exhibitors and you, our visitors. Our priority at all times is that everyone can have a safe experience and unfortunately this means that at times we cannot allow access to the Cattle Hall.
